|
|
|
@ -1,5 +1,6 @@ |
|
|
|
import 'package:dating_touchme_app/controller/discover/room_controller.dart'; |
|
|
|
import 'package:dating_touchme_app/controller/global.dart'; |
|
|
|
import 'package:dating_touchme_app/controller/mine/rose_controller.dart'; |
|
|
|
import 'package:dating_touchme_app/controller/overlay_controller.dart'; |
|
|
|
import 'package:dating_touchme_app/extension/ex_fuction.dart'; |
|
|
|
import 'package:dating_touchme_app/generated/assets.dart'; |
|
|
|
@ -211,16 +212,22 @@ class _LiveRoomPageState extends State<LiveRoomPage> { |
|
|
|
); |
|
|
|
} |
|
|
|
|
|
|
|
void _showRechargePopup() { |
|
|
|
void _showRechargePopup() async { |
|
|
|
// 隐藏键盘 |
|
|
|
FocusScope.of(context).unfocus(); |
|
|
|
_roomController.setDialogDismiss(true); |
|
|
|
final roseController = Get.isRegistered<RoseController>() |
|
|
|
? Get.find<RoseController>() |
|
|
|
: Get.put(RoseController()); |
|
|
|
|
|
|
|
await roseController.getRoseNum(); |
|
|
|
SmartDialog.show( |
|
|
|
alignment: Alignment.bottomCenter, |
|
|
|
maskColor: TDTheme.of(context).fontGyColor2, |
|
|
|
onDismiss: (){ |
|
|
|
_roomController.setDialogDismiss(false); |
|
|
|
}, |
|
|
|
|
|
|
|
builder: (_) => const LiveRechargePopup(), |
|
|
|
); |
|
|
|
} |
|
|
|
|